Why Your Mattress Needs Protection
A mattress is used more consistently than almost any other piece of furniture in a home. Most people spend several hours on it every night. Over time, a mattress can be exposed to sweat, drinks, food, pet accidents, children’s accidents, cosmetics, and other sources of moisture or staining.
Even a careful household can experience an unexpected spill.
A glass of water may tip over on a nightstand. A child may climb into bed with a drink. A pet may have an accident. Someone recovering from illness may spend more time than usual in bed. A roof leak, moving accident, or household mishap can create a problem without warning.
The purpose of a mattress protector is not to suggest that these events happen constantly. It is to provide a defensive layer for the times when they do.
The Weekender Jersey Mattress Protector includes a waterproof layer designed to protect the top of the mattress from accidents and spills. Its surface is made from polyester jersey fabric, while the backing is polyurethane.
Without a protector, a liquid can pass through a fitted sheet and reach the mattress itself. Unlike a sheet or blanket, a mattress cannot simply be placed in a washing machine. Cleaning the affected area may require significant effort, and a stain or odor may remain even after the surface has dried.
Using a washable protector creates a removable barrier that is much easier to maintain than the mattress beneath it.

Waterproof Protection for Everyday Life
The waterproof backing is the protector’s most important functional feature.
A regular fitted sheet can keep the mattress surface clean from some dust and ordinary contact, but it is not designed to stop liquid. Once moisture passes through a sheet, it can be absorbed by the fabric and comfort materials inside the mattress.
The Weekender protector places a polyurethane waterproof barrier beneath the soft jersey surface. This helps prevent ordinary spills and accidents from reaching the top of the mattress.
It is important to describe this protection accurately. The product covers the top and fitted sides of the mattress. It is not a fully sealed mattress encasement surrounding all six sides. It should not be treated as permission to deliberately expose the bed to large amounts of liquid.
Instead, it is a sensible protective measure for ordinary household risks.
The best time to install a protector is when the mattress is still new and clean. Waiting until after the first spill defeats much of the purpose. Putting the protector on immediately gives the mattress protection from its first night of regular use.

Machine-Washable Convenience
A protector is most useful when it can be cleaned without becoming a major project.
The Weekender Jersey Mattress Protector is machine washable and can be tumble dried on low heat according to available product instructions.
Customers should still read and follow the care label included with the protector. Waterproof materials can be damaged by excessive heat, harsh washing methods, ironing, or other treatment that may be safe for ordinary sheets but inappropriate for a waterproof backing.
The protector does not necessarily need to be washed every time the sheets are changed. The appropriate schedule depends on the household, whether a spill occurred, whether pets or children use the bed, and personal cleaning preferences.
After an accident or liquid spill, the protector should be removed and cleaned promptly. Before remaking the bed, confirm that both the protector and mattress surface are fully dry.

A Mattress Protector Is Not the Same as a Mattress Pad
The terms “mattress protector,” “mattress pad,” and “mattress topper” are sometimes used interchangeably, but they serve different primary purposes.
A mattress protector is mainly intended to defend the mattress from moisture and ordinary contamination.
A mattress pad may add a modest amount of cushioning while providing some surface protection.
A mattress topper is generally much thicker and is intended to alter the comfort or feel of the mattress.
The Weekender Jersey Mattress Protector is not designed to make a firm mattress plush or repair an old, uncomfortable bed. It is a thin protective product designed to sit beneath the fitted sheet.
Customers who need a different comfort level should focus first on selecting the appropriate mattress. The protector helps preserve that mattress after the decision has been made.
Protection Does Not Replace Proper Mattress Care
A protector is useful, but it is only one part of caring for a mattress.
The mattress should still be placed on a suitable foundation or platform. Bedding should be cleaned regularly. The bedroom should receive appropriate ventilation. Spills should be addressed promptly, even when a protector is present.
Customers should also follow the mattress manufacturer’s support, rotation, cleaning, and warranty instructions.
A protector cannot reverse wear, repair structural damage, or make an unsuitable foundation appropriate. Its role is narrower and more realistic: helping defend the sleep surface against everyday spills and accidents.
